Civic engagement encompasses active citizenship, community involvement, advocacy, awareness of social issues and injustices, and the development of personal and social responsibility.  It requires students to involve themselves in society with the intent to better the world around them.

There are numerous ways students, faculty and staff can civically engage here at Towson University.
